EDITORS COMMENTS
Betty Balfour, a prominent British actress of the 1920s, poses for a promotional photograph in character for her role in the 1926 silent film "The Sea Urchin," directed by Graham Cutts. The film, released in 1927, was produced by the prestigious Gainsborough Pictures and marked a significant moment in Betty's career. In this image, Betty, dressed in a stylish 1920s outfit, exudes an air of sophistication and mystery. The film, set in the jazz age, follows the story of a young woman who becomes embroiled in a dangerous love triangle and must navigate the treacherous waters of deceit and betrayal. Betty's performance in "The Sea Urchin" was widely praised, and she went on to become one of the most popular and successful British actresses of the era. This photograph captures a moment in time, showcasing Betty's charm and allure, and offers a glimpse into the historical significance of British silent films during the 1920s.
